Opioid Crisis: Georgia Mourns Death Of Two Friends On Same Day And Just Half A Mile Apart
Tech Times
Two teenagers died of fentanyl overdose in Georgia. The pair, who were friends, had reportedly bought the opioids from the same dealer. ( Ewa Urban ). Teenagers Joseph Abraham, 19, and Dustin Manning, 18, died on May 26 after battling drug addiction.
